- מִיכָיָה - H4320 4320 - from (04310) and (the prefix derivative from) (03588) and (03050) - Miykayah - me-kaw-yaw' - Proper Name Masculine - from «04310» and (the prefix derivative from) «03588» and «03050»; who (is) like Jah?; Micajah, the name of two Israelites:--Micah, Michaiah. Compare «04318». - Micah or Michaiah = "who is like God"
- the 6th in order of the minor prophets; a native of Moresheth, he prophesied during the reigns of Jotham, Ahaz, and Hezekiah of Judah, and was contemporary with the prophets Hosea, Amos, and Isaiah
- father of Achbor, a man of high station in the reign of Josiah
- one of the priests at the dedication of the wall of Jerusalem
